Location:
Inglewood Primary School, 33 Kelly Street, Inglewood.
Team:
Puke Haupapa White Mural Project Class and Tracy White. The whole class helped come up with the concept with six main students doing the bulk of the painting.
Accessible to public:
Yes.
Mural theme:
Kohanga Moa.
Background to mural creation:
The mural is designed to represent the children and the Whanau hubs using the trees and birds of the kura (Miro, Kauri, Kowhai and Rata trees and the juniors represented by the Pepe fern frond). The school mascot, the moa, is hiding amongst the trees in the Waionganga Iti river that flows beside the kura. The mural at the front gate represents the school and the community.
